Episode Description

Why do many business owners, CEOs, and plant managers struggle with their role as leaders? What does effectiveness mean for leaders? How can visuality help leaders be more effective? In this show, Gwendolyn Galsworth (your host and visual workplace expert) continues her walk through the fourth doorway into the visual workplace: Visual Leadership. At this point in Doorway 4, visual metrics are in place; visual problem solving is propelling the workforce down the causal chain; standards are improving and visual solutions are stabilizing those improvements. Leaders are now able to see their organizations behave and it is their turn to step up to their role as visual leaders—owners of the organizational horizon as well as the pacing and will needed to drive the enterprise towards it with focus, confidence, and certainty. Tune in and learn why good leaders always crave excellence and how visuality can help them both sharpen and satisfy that hunger.

Gwendolyn D. Galsworth, Ph.D.

Gwendolyn D. Galsworth, PhD, is president and founder of Visual Thinking Inc. and The Visual-Lean Institute(r), a training, consulting, and research firm in visual workplace technologies. Over a period of 30 years, Dr. Galsworth has codified the field of visuality into a single coherent framework of thinking and application called the 10-Doorway Model.

In 2005, Dr. Galsworth established the Visual-Lean(r) Institute where in-house and external trainers are licensed in nine core visual workplace courses.

Four of her nine courses are now available as on-line training systems (English/Spanish), with more to come. Galsworth is author of seven books, including two Shingo Prize winners: Visual Workplace/Visual Thinking and Work That Makes Sense, available from her website and Amazon.

Dr. Galsworth began in the 1980s as the head of training/development at Productivity Inc. She worked closely with Dr. Ryuji Fukuda to adapt the CEDAC(r) method for western companies, and with Dr. Shigeo Shingo to develop, among many things, poka-yoke for the West. She was principal developer of Visual Factory, TEIAN (operator-led suggestion systems), and the X-Type Matrix.

A Fellow on the Shingo Institute Faculty and former Baldrige and Shingo Examiners, Galsworth has led study missions to some of the world’s finest companies, including in Japan. Dr. Galsworth lives in New England where she happily works, hikes, and writes.
